How Sewer Backup Water Removal Actually Works
When you experience a sewer backup, it’s not just a matter of calling a restoration company, it’s a process. Our team follows a strict protocol to ensure your property is safe, dry, and restored to its original condition. From initial assessment to the final walk-through, we’ll be with you every step of the way, explaining what’s happening and why.
Step 1: Initial Assessment
Our team arrives on-site, assesses the damage, and provides a detailed report on what’s needed to restore your property. We’ll explain the process, answer your questions, and provide a clear estimate of the costs involved.
Step 2: Water Removal
We’ll use state-of-the-art equipment to quickly and safely remove the standing water, reducing the risk of further damage and mold grow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use industrial-grade drying equipment to remove any remaining moisture from your property, including walls, floors, and ceilings. This step is crucial to preventing mold and mildew growth.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We’ll thoroughly clean and sanitize all affected areas, including walls, floors, and surfaces, to remove any remaining bacteria, viruses, or other contaminants.
Step 5: Restoration and Repairs
Our team will work with you to identify and repair any structural damage, including drywall, flooring, and other affected areas. We’ll also provide guidance on how to prevent future backups.

Sewer Backup Water Removal Cost in Lucas, TX
The cost of sewer backup water removal services can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Lucas, TX. Our team will provide a detailed estimate of the costs involved, including any necessary repairs or restorations.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Report | $500 – $2,500 | The severity of the damage and size of the affected area. |
| Water Removal and Dr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| The amount of water removed and the complexity of the drying process. |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of cleaning required. |
| Restoration and Repairs | $2,000 – $10,000 | The extent of the damage and the type of repairs needed. |
| Total Cost | $3,000 – $19,500 | The combination of the services listed above, including any necessary repairs or restorations. |
